The main components of Morodan are Lily, Poria, Scrophularia, Linderae, Alisma orientalis, Ophiopogon japonicus, Angelica sinensis, Atractylodis Rhizoma, Herba Artemisiae Scopariae, Radix Paeoniae Alba, Dendrobium, Rhizoma Acori Graminei, Rhizoma Chuanxiong, Radix Notoginseng, Sanguisorba officinalis, Rhizoma Corydalis, Pollen Typhae and Endothelium Corneum Gigeriae Galli. Morodan has the effects of regulating stomach, lowering adverse qi, invigorating spleen, relieving flatulence, dredging collaterals and relieving pain.
Morodan is used for chronic atrophic gastritis, with symptoms such as stomachache, fullness, fullness, anorexia and belching. This product is a brown concentrated pill; It tastes slightly bitter.
